What a let down today was,  after a fantastic summer down under.  Where was that fighting team that went to Australia?

The West Indies is showing more nerve at the wicket in their current series against England!

It was so disappointing to see a good team under perform.  And the way Graeme Smith lost his wicket in the second innings, probably told a story of a team that were not going to stay at the crease for a full day.

What happened with Dale Steyn’s bowling?  At the Wanderers one would have expected a bit better from him.

It’s easy to blame the players, because we see them not performing as one would have expected, but I’m sure they’re even more disappointed than us the fans.

The biggest culprits in this loss is Mike Proctor and his fellow selectors.  They should have included Ashwell Prince in the squad, if not the team.  Instead we heard how hard it was to leave Prince out and how sorry they were to have to choose JP Duminy based on his performances in Australia.  Whatever!

The brave and smart thing to do would have been to pick one of their most reliable players over the past few seasons and then picked between Duminy and the undeserving Neil Mckenzie.

If Graeme Smith and the team thinks Mckenzie brings soooo much to the dressing room, then he can be picked as a twelfth man or team vice-psychologist or something. 

South Africa however needs someone to steady the middle order until Jacques Kallis is consistently scoring hundreds again.  AB de Villiers can’t be expected to carry the middle order alone!

Anyway the Proteas are now in the position of underdogs again,  a position they have recently enjoyed.  They’ve come from behind a few times in the last year or so and gone onto win matches.

I’m sure they’ll come back fighting – it would just be nice to know that they have a fighting man in the team instead of having him play domestic cricket back in Port Elizabeth.
